The Dangers of Cell Phone Use During Driving in NYC
In today’s digital age, cell phone use while driving has become a significant concern in New York City, contributing to numerous car accidents and causing severe injuries or even fatalities. The distraction posed by mobile devices can significantly impair a driver’s ability to react promptly, especially in fast-paced urban environments like NYC. When drivers engage in activities such as texting, making calls, or browsing the internet while behind the wheel, their attention is diverted from the road, leading to delayed reaction times and reduced awareness of surroundings.
New York City, with its bustling streets and heavy traffic, demands a high level of focus from all drivers. Cell phone distractions can be particularly dangerous due to the city’s dense population and complex road network. Car accidents caused by cell phone use result in not only physical harm but also legal repercussions. The consequences can include fines, license suspension, or even criminal charges for reckless driving. It is crucial for NYC residents and visitors alike to prioritize safety by putting away mobile devices while operating motor vehicles to prevent car accidents and protect themselves and others on the road.
Navigating Car Accident Claims: What to Do After an Incident in Brooklyn
After a car accident in Brooklyn, navigating your claim can be daunting, especially if cell phone use was a factor. In New York City, including Brooklyn, it’s against the law to send or read text messages while driving, and this includes using hands-free devices. If you’ve been involved in an accident due to a driver’s distraction from their phone, understanding your legal options is crucial.
The first step is to ensure everyone’s safety and call emergency services if needed. Document the scene with photos of damage, exchange insurance information with the other party, and gather contact details of witnesses. In New York, you have three years to file a personal injury lawsuit after an accident. A car crash lawyer in Brooklyn can help guide you through the process, especially when dealing with complex issues like cell phone distractions, which could significantly impact your claim.
